Note
8.
 Contract balance
 
The Company’s service contracts include an upfront payment for the one,
two
or
three
-year contract terms. The timing of receipt of payment and timing of performance of the services create timing differences that result in deferred revenue on the Company’s condensed consolidated balance sheet. The advance payments under these contracts are recorded in deferred revenue, and the Company recognizes the revenue when earned. Contracted but unsatisfied performance obligations were approximately
$11.8
million as of
June 30, 2018,
of which the Company expects to recognize approximately
78%
of the revenue over the next
12
months and the remainder thereafter.
 
The Company's deferred contract revenue consists of service revenue, training and product revenue. Deferred contract revenue balance is comprised mainly of Service revenue. The Company generates Service revenue from the sale of extended service contracts and from time and material services provided to customers who are
not
under a warranty or extended service contract. Service contract revenue is recognized on a straight-line basis over the period of the applicable contract. Service revenue from time and material services is recognized as the services are provided.
